The Larval Phase

Grubs are C-shaped, creamy-white larvae with chocolate-brown heads. They are most active in late spring and early fall when soil temperatures are ideal. If you observe your supergrass pulling up like a piece of rug, it is a primary index of a grub plague.

The Adult Phase

Adult June glitch egress in late spring or other summer. They are nocturnal and are extremely appeal to bright porch light and garden clarification. While the adult have less impairment than the larvae, their presence indicates that egg are being set in your filth, insure the round continues.

Managing Adult Populations

Since adults are drawn to light, changing your outdoor clarification is a unproblematic but effective hindrance. Swap from white-spectrum LED or mercury evaporation lightbulb to warmer, yellow-hued lightbulb can importantly reduce the number of beetles circling your patio or door at nighttime.

Physical Barriers

For high-value plants, lightweight horticultural material or veiling can function as a physical roadblock during peak growth periods in May and June. This prevents female from bring on the soil to deposit their egg, efficaciously breaking the reproductive cycle.
